Sure it does. Apple has been shipping machines with free upgrades to 10.8 for the last few weeks. Customers simply had to wait until release before installing it. A lot, probably most, of those people are going to grab the upgrade simply because it was paid for in the price of their computer (and they have to claim it within a month of release). Very few of these people explicitly purchased 10.8, and it does not represent additional revenues to Apple. So from the sales perspective, Apple's 3 million in 3 days is a bit deceptive.
